Output 91639cab3f7f4c31b8c11269bab0195a432d4868996002e5a12a195a0428b150:19

value
50722096
script pubkey
OP_0 OP_PUSHBYTES_20 0662596d275ccf364318471a532241afae641d6b
address
bc1qqe39jmf8tn8nvsccgud9xgjp47hxg8ttq297y8
transaction
91639cab3f7f4c31b8c11269bab0195a432d4868996002e5a12a195a0428b150